[Retracted] The Correlation between Functional Connectivity of the Primary Somatosensory Cortex and Cervical Spinal Cord Microstructural Injury in Patients with Cervical Spondylotic Myelopathy

Figure 4

(a)–(c) Correlation analysis of mean ADC and FA value in the CSM group. The results showed that mean FA values of the cervical spinal cord in CSM patients were positively correlated with JOA scores, JOA scores of motor function and lower limb motor function. (d)–(f) Correlation analysis of ADCpos and FApos value in the CSM group. The results showed that FApos values of bilateral posterior funiculus were positively correlated with JOA scores and JOA scores of sensory function and lower limb sensory function.
